AB68-SA1,215 17Section 215. 118.51 (9) of the statutes is amended to read:
AB68-SA1,69,318 118.51 (9) Appeal of rejection. If the nonresident school board rejects an
19application under sub. (3) (a) or (7), the resident school board prohibits a pupil from
20attending public school in a nonresident school district under sub. (3m) (d) or the
21nonresident school board prohibits a pupil from attending public school in the
22nonresident school district under sub. (11), the pupil's parent may appeal the
23decision to the department within 30 days after the decision. If the nonresident
24school board provides notice that the special education or related service is not
25available under sub. (12) (b), the pupil's parent may appeal the required transfer to

1the department within 30 days after receipt of the notice. The department shall
2affirm the school board's decision unless the department finds that the decision was
3arbitrary or unreasonable.
